ThesisAI is the world's first AI-powered assistant capable of drafting a complete scientific document based on a single prompt. It can generate documents up to 50 pages long. The platform supports native LaTeX and Overleaf integration for manual editing. Users can upload up to 100 reference papers for citations. ThesisAI offers outputs in various formats, including PDF, LaTeX, and BibTeX, making it a comprehensive tool for researchers and students needing thorough and citation-rich scientific documents.

ThesisAI Pro & Cons
The Cons
AI-generated content may still be detected as AI-originated
Exact page control for documents is limited due to non-deterministic LLM behavior
Potential occasional syntax issues in PDF generation requiring manual fixes
No open-source code or GitHub repository publicly available
The Pros
Can generate up to 50-page scientific documents from a single prompt
Supports inline citations and full literature reviews based on up to 100 papers
Multilingual support for document creation in over 20 languages
Integrates with Overleaf, Zotero, and Mendeley for enhanced workflow
Multiple output formats including PDF, Word, LaTeX, and BibTeX
